General Description:

A phenomenal student services position is available for a dynamic and motivated individual looking to grow their career in higher education at Niagara County Community College. To be successful in this role, you will need to have excellent communication, organizational and customer service skills. This position reports directly to the Assistant Vice President of Student Services.

The Student Success Center's Success Coach is responsible for the tracking, assisting, and monitoring the progress of an assigned cohort of students. Specific responsibilities include but are not limited to providing advisement support, developing and conducting workshops, monitoring student academic progress, supporting continuous student enrollment, and ensuring students receive information on available academic and student support services. Documentation of services and student progress is an essential requirement of this position. Evening and/or weekend hours may be required.

Typical Work Activities:

  • Provide support for participants on both a scheduled and drop-in basis to include but not limited to providing information, support, and resources about advisement, academic requirements, financial aid, career planning, employment, and 4-year college transfer.
  • Use a case management approach to guiding students in managing their academic experience and engaging them in activities that support their success (tutoring, personal counseling, workshops on self-management, etc.).
  • Monitor and document student progress at the College through frequent individual meetings, monitoring of mid-term reports, and advance registration.
  • Serve as a technical resource for faculty and staff to identify campus connections and resources that foster student retention.
  • Support activities related to the enrollment process, orientation, advisement and additional functions as required by the Assistant Vice President of Student Services.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.

Essential Functions:

Ability to relate to a diverse student population; ability to relate to all members of the college staff and faculty; ability to manage multiple functions; ability to operate computers; ability to prepare and make presentations to groups, ability to prepare written reports, ability to physically perform the duties of the position.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Education or Counseling OR
  • Bachelor's Degree and the equivalent of four months (one semester) full-time experience working in an educational environment;
  • Demonstrable effective written communication skills;
  • Experience interacting with a diverse population.

    About Niagara County Community College
    Our college nurtures and empowers its students and employees in ways that recognize and value our common humanity as well as the richness of our diversity. NCCC offers high-quality academic programs leading to degrees and certificates which are supported by outstanding student services in an inclusive and welcoming environment. NCCC provides a variety of cultural, social, and international experiences, as well as community education and workforce development that supports economic development that positively impacts the quality of life of valued stake-holders. The College operates through a collegial model of shared governance and transparency, and is accountable to meet the highest standards of professionalism and integrity. Established in 1962, NCCC offers a comprehensive and vibrant learning environment with an enrollment of approximately 3,090 students (Fall 2021 semester). The student to faculty ratio is 12:1, providing a high degree of personalized attention and connection between students and faculty. The NCCC campus, located in Sanborn, NY, offers easy access to both Buffalo, NY and Niagara Falls State Park, and is minutes from the Canadian border. The campus is centr...ally located between the county’s three main cities of Lockport, Niagara Falls, and North Tonawanda. NCCC serves the community in two locations within Niagara County, at the Sanborn campus, and at the Niagara Falls Culinary Institute, located in the heart of downtown Niagara Falls. NCCC continues to actively expand with the recent opening of its Learning Commons Center, a $25 million dollar project on the Sanborn campus. In just a short period of time, it has become the nucleus of the campus; a place for faculty to collaborate and help students develop critical thinking skills while incorporating state-of-the-art technology and innovative student support services.
